A web map contains a JSON defining the bookmarks, layers, their symbology, order and other cartographic information. Working with web mapsĢD maps in your GIS are stored as web map items. In this guide we will observe how to work maps and scenes using the arcgis.mapping module. Web maps and scenes are stored as items on your portal and their content is in JavaScript Object Notation (JSON), a text format that can easily be transferred, stored, and edited. Web maps can also be configured for offline use if your mobile workers work in areas without a reliable internet connection. When used with an internet connection, web maps allow mobile workers to access the same data used in the office. A web scene is analogous to a web map but in the 3D space. Web mapIf your mobile workers always have an internet connection, even out in the field, provide a web map.
